Indonesia Stone Market Overview

The Indonesia stone market was valued at USD 937 million. Growth is driven by booming construction, rising demand for decorative stones, and expanding infrastructure projects, with natural stones favored for residential and commercial uses due to their durability and aesthetic appeal.

The key players in Indonesia's natural stone market include Jakarta, Surabaya, and Bandung. Jakarta leads due to urbanization and infrastructure development, driving high demand. Surabaya and Bandung benefit from proximity to abundant stone quarries and a growing middle class, fueling demand for quality stone products. These cities dominate due to strategic locations and robust construction activities supporting market growth.

The Indonesian government has not specifically implemented new 2023 regulations mandating environmental impact assessments or incentives exclusively for sustainable stone mining. However, recent regulatory updates, including Government Regulation and amendments to mining laws, focus on improving mining area management, legal certainty, and promoting domestic mineral processing, indirectly supporting sustainable practices in the mining sector.

Indonesia Stone Market Segmentation

By Source: The market is segmented into natural stones and artificial stones. Natural stones, including granite, marble, and limestone, dominate the market due to their aesthetic appeal and durability. The increasing trend of using natural stones in residential and commercial projects, driven by consumer preferences for sustainable materials, has led to a significant rise in their demand. Artificial stones, while gaining traction due to their cost-effectiveness and versatility, still lag behind in market share compared to natural stones.

By Application: The primary applications of stone in the market include construction, landscaping, and interior design. The construction segment holds the largest share, driven by the ongoing infrastructure projects and urban development initiatives across Indonesia. The demand for stones in landscaping and interior design is also on the rise, as consumers increasingly seek to enhance the aesthetic appeal of their properties. This trend is particularly evident in urban areas where outdoor spaces are being transformed into green landscapes.

Indonesia Stone Market Industry Analysis

Growth Drivers

Increasing Demand for Construction Materials: Indonesia's construction sector is growing steadily, supported by substantial government infrastructure projects and rising private investments. The population is expected to reach approximately 277 million by 2024, increasing the need for housing and commercial developments. This urbanization and economic growth are driving demand for stone materials used in foundations, facades, and landscaping. Major projects like the new capital city, Nusantara, and extensive road and transportation initiatives further propel the market, significantly boosting demand for construction materials nationwide.

Rising Urbanization and Infrastructure Development: Indonesia's urban population is projected to reach around 165.7 million in 2024, accounting for approximately 59% of the total population. This rapid urbanization drives extensive infrastructure development, including roads, bridges, and public facilities. The government's commitment to investing USD 450 billion in infrastructure over the next five years further boosts demand for stone products, which are essential for these projects. This combination of urban growth and massive infrastructure spending is a key driver of expansion in Indonesia's stone industry.

Growing Interest in Sustainable Building Practices: Sustainability is gaining momentum in Indonesia's construction sector, with green building certifications increasing by about 15% annually. Builders and consumers are prioritizing eco-friendly materials and energy-efficient designs, aligning with the government's Net Zero Emissions goals. Natural stone, valued for its environmental benefits and durability, is increasingly used in sustainable projects. This shift supports market growth and reflects broader trends toward green construction, driven by rising environmental awareness, regulatory support, and initiatives like the "3 Million Houses" program promoting affordable, sustainable housing.

Market Challenges

Fluctuating Raw Material Prices: The stone market faces challenges due to the volatility in raw material prices. Factors such as global supply chain disruptions and changes in mining regulations contribute to this instability. Such price fluctuations can impact profit margins for manufacturers and lead to increased costs for consumers, posing a significant challenge to market stability and growth.

Environmental Regulations and Compliance Costs: The Indonesia stone market faces challenges due to increasing environmental regulations and stricter mining laws. These regulations require companies to invest in sustainable mining practices, pollution control, and land rehabilitation, which increases operational costs

Indonesia Stone Market Future Outlook

The Indonesia stone market is poised for significant growth, driven by ongoing urbanization and a shift towards sustainable construction practices. As the government continues to invest in infrastructure, the demand for stone products is expected to rise. Additionally, technological advancements in stone processing will enhance product quality and efficiency. Companies that adapt to these trends and focus on eco-friendly solutions will likely capture a larger market share, positioning themselves favorably for future opportunities.

Market Opportunities

Expansion into Emerging Markets: The Indonesia stone market is expected to grow annually by urbanization and infrastructure development. Emerging Southeast Asian markets, fueled by rising middle-class income, offer stone manufacturers significant opportunities, with regional demand growth supporting expansion and increased sales in construction materials across developing economies.

Technological Advancements in Stone Processing: Innovations in stone processing technology, including automated cutting and advanced finishing, can reduce production costs by up to 25-27%, enhancing efficiency and product quality. These advancements enable companies to offer customized stone products, meeting growing demand in the interior design and construction sectors while improving profit margins and competitive positioning in the Indonesia stone market.
